@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Black"),url(../fonts/RFDewiExtended-Black.woff2) format("woff2"),url(../fonts/RFDewiExtended-Black.woff) format("woff");font-weight:900;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Ultrabold"),url(../fonts/RFDewiExtended-Ultrabold.woff2) format("woff2"),url(../fonts/RFDewiExtended-Ultrabold.woff) format("woff");font-weight:800;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Bold"),url(../fonts/RFDewiExtended-Bold.woff2) format("woff2"),url(../fonts/RFDewiExtended-Bold.woff) format("woff");font-weight:700;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Semibold"),url(../fonts/RFDewiExtended-Semibold.woff2) format("woff2"),url(../fonts/RFDewiExtended-Semibold.woff) format("woff");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Regular"),url(../fonts/RFDewiExtended-Regular.woff2) format("woff2"),url(../fonts/RFDewiExtended-Regular.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Light"),url(../fonts/RFDewiExtended-Light.woff2) format("woff2"),url(../fonts/RFDewiExtended-Light.woff) format("woff");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Ultralight"),url(../fonts/RFDewiExtended-Ultralight.woff2) format("woff2"),url(../fonts/RFDewiExtended-Ultralight.woff) format("woff");font-weight:200;font-style:normal;font-display:swap}@font-face{font-family:RFDewiExtended;src:local("RFDewiExtended-Thin"),url(../fonts/RFDewiExtended-Thin.woff2) format("woff2"),url(../fonts/RFDewiExtended-Thin.woff) format("woff");font-weight:100;font-style:normal;font-display:swap}@font-face{font-family:SFProText;src:local("SFProDisplay-Regular"),url(../fonts/SFProDisplay-Regular.woff2) format("woff2"),url(../fonts/SFProDisplay-Regular.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}body{background:#fafcff}body,html{overflow-x:hidden}.container{position:relative;max-width:1262px;width:100%;margin:0 auto}@media screen and (max-width:1299px){.container{max-width:960px}}@media screen and (max-width:991px){.container{max-width:720px}}@media screen and (max-width:767px){.container{max-width:540px}}.logo{display:block;width:-webkit-max-content;width:-moz-max-content;width:max-content;margin:0 auto}.logo__img{display:block;width:306px}.title-main{font-family:RFDewiExtended;font-style:normal;font-weight:700;font-size:52px;line-height:107%;text-align:center;letter-spacing:-.01em;color:#344463}@media screen and (max-width:1299px){.title-main{font-size:48px}}@media screen and (max-width:991px){.title-main{font-size:44px}}@media screen and (max-width:575px){.container{max-width:100%;padding:0 22px}.logo__img{width:213px}.title-main{font-size:35px}}.title-main .colored{background:-o-linear-gradient(183.08deg,#6395f8 6.31%,#b68fff 91.68%);background:linear-gradient(266.92deg,#6395f8 6.31%,#b68fff 91.68%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-fill-color:transparent}.btn{padding:21px 145px;border:none;background:-o-linear-gradient(183.08deg,#7caef5 6.31%,#bbb8f7 91.68%);background:linear-gradient(266.92deg,#7caef5 6.31%,#bbb8f7 91.68%);border-radius:25px;font-family:RFDewiExtended;font-style:normal;font-weight:600;font-size:18px;line-height:143.84%;color:#15172a;outline:0;cursor:pointer;-webkit-box-shadow:0 20px 34px rgba(0,0,0,.23);box-shadow:0 20px 34px rgba(0,0,0,.23);-webkit-transition:.3s cubic-bezier(.075,.82,.165,1);-o-transition:.3s cubic-bezier(.075,.82,.165,1);transition:.3s cubic-bezier(.075,.82,.165,1)}@media screen and (max-width:991px){.btn{font-size:16px;padding:17px 130px;border-radius:21px}}.btn:hover{background:-o-linear-gradient(183.08deg,#6395f8 6.31%,#b68fff 91.68%),-o-linear-gradient(183.08deg,#7caef5 6.31%,#bbb8f7 91.68%);background:linear-gradient(266.92deg,#6395f8 6.31%,#b68fff 91.68%),linear-gradient(266.92deg,#7caef5 6.31%,#bbb8f7 91.68%)}br.mobile{display:none}@media screen and (max-width:575px){.btn{width:100%;font-size:16px;padding:16px;border-radius:21px}br.mobile{display:inline-block}}.hero{padding-top:20px;padding-bottom:40px}.hero__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ding-top:48px}.hero__title{max-width:700px;margin-bottom:24px}.hero__text{max-width:576px;margin-bottom:48px;font-family:RFDewiExtended;font-style:normal;font-weight:600;font-size:20px;line-height:135%;text-align:center;color:#344463}@media screen and (max-width:575px){.hero__body{padding-top:33px}.hero__text{margin-bottom:24px;font-size:18px}}.now{padding-top:55px;padding-bottom:20px}.now__list{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;position:relative}.now__item{position:absolute;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);border-radius:46px;overflow:hidden;-webkit-box-shadow:0 20px 34px rgba(0,0,0,.23);box-shadow:0 20px 34px rgba(0,0,0,.23);max-width:660px}.now__item::before{z-index:2;content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(40,45,73,.7)}.now__item:nth-of-type(1){z-index:3;top:0;left:0;position:relative;-webkit-transform:none;-ms-transform:none;transform:none}.now__item:nth-of-type(1)::before{background:-webkit-gradient(linear,left top,left bottom,from(rgba(40,45,73,0)),color-stop(31.6%,rgba(40,45,73,.2706)),to(rgba(40,45,73,.82)));background:-o-linear-gradient(top,rgba(40,45,73,0) 0,rgba(40,45,73,.2706) 31.6%,rgba(40,45,73,.82) 100%);background:linear-gradient(180deg,rgba(40,45,73,0) 0,rgba(40,45,73,.2706) 31.6%,rgba(40,45,73,.82) 100%)}.now__item:nth-of-type(1) .now__item-bg{-webkit-filter:none;filter:none}.now__item:nth-of-type(1):hover .now__item-icon{-webkit-transform:scale(1.1);-ms-transform:scale(1.1);transform:scale(1.1)}.now__item:nth-of-type(2),.now__item:nth-of-type(3){z-index:2;min-width:540px}.now__item:nth-of-type(2){margin-left:-325px}.now__item:nth-of-type(3){margin-left:325px}.now__item:nth-of-type(4),.now__item:nth-of-type(5){z-index:1;min-width:452px}.now__item:nth-of-type(4) .now__item-title,.now__item:nth-of-type(5) .now__item-title{font-size:20px}.now__item:nth-of-type(4){margin-left:-540px}.now__item:nth-of-type(5){margin-left:540px}.now__item-inner{z-index:5;position:absolute;top:50%;left:50%;color:#fff;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.now__item-play{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;cursor:pointer}.now__item-icon{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;border-radius:50%;margin-left:auto;margin-right:auto;margin-bottom:11px;-webkit-transition:.3s;-o-transition:.3s;transition:.3s}.now__item-icon.--lock{width:56px;height:56px;border:1.5px solid rgba(226,232,241,.5)}.now__item-icon.--play{width:69px;height:69px;padding-left:3px;background:-o-linear-gradient(183.08deg,#6395f8 6.31%,#b68fff 91.68%);background:linear-gradient(266.92deg,#6395f8 6.31%,#b68fff 91.68%)}.now__item-desc{font-family:RFDewiExtended;font-size:15px;line-height:1.3;text-align:center}.now__item-desc.--bold{font-weight:700;font-size:16px;line-height:111.2%}.now__item-title{z-index:6;position:absolute;left:0;right:0;bottom:45px;padding-left:10px;padding-right:10px;font-family:RFDewiExtended;font-style:normal;font-weight:700;font-size:25px;line-height:111.2%;letter-spacing:-.02em;color:#f4f7fe;width:100%;text-align:center}.now__item-bg{-webkit-filter:blur(10px);filter:blur(10px);-webkit-transform:scale(1.1);-ms-transform:scale(1.1);transform:scale(1.1)}.now__item-bg img{z-index:1;position:relative;width:100%}@media screen and (max-width:1300px){.now__item:nth-of-type(2){margin-left:-150px}.now__item:nth-of-type(3){margin-left:150px}.now__item:nth-of-type(4){margin-left:-250px}.now__item:nth-of-type(5){margin-left:250px}}@media screen and (max-width:1199px){.now__left{max-width:415px}.now__right{padding-right:0;max-width:400px}}@media screen and (max-width:992px){.now__left{max-width:100%;margin-bottom:24px}.now__right{max-width:100%}.now__btn{margin-right:0}}@media screen and (max-width:767px){.now{padding-left:22px;padding-right:22px}.now__inner{padding:56px 22px 90px;margin-left:-22px;margin-right:-22px}.now__title{font-size:20px;line-height:24px}.now__text{font-size:16px;line-height:24px}.now__text p{margin-bottom:24px}.now__text p:last-child{margin-bottom:0}.now .container{padding-left:0;padding-right:0;max-width:100%}.now__list{padding-left:28px;padding-right:28px;margin-top:-40px}.now__item{-webkit-transform:none;-ms-transform:none;transform:none;min-width:1px!important}.now__item:nth-of-type(1){min-height:315px}.now__item:nth-of-type(1) .now__item-bg{width:100%;height:100%;-webkit-transform:none;-ms-transform:none;transform:none}.now__item:nth-of-type(2){z-index:2;top:25px;bottom:25px;left:-8px;right:-8px;margin-left:0}.now__item:nth-of-type(3){z-index:1;top:44px;bottom:44px;left:-32px;right:-32px;margin-left:0}.now__item-title,.now__item:nth-of-type(4),.now__item:nth-of-type(5){display:none}.now__item-icon.--play{padding:17px;width:51px;height:51px}.now__item-icon.--play svg{position:relative;left:2px}.now__item-desc.--bold{font-size:14px;line-height:15px}.now__item-bg img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}}.pluses{position:relative}.pluses__grid{position:relative;z-index:2;padding-top:309px;padding-bottom:281px;max-width:543px}.pluses__text{font-family:RFDewiExtended;font-style:normal;font-weight:600;font-size:25px;line-height:143.84%;color:#344463}.pluses__img{position:absolute;z-index:2;top:172px;right:-144px}@media screen and (max-width:1299px){.pluses__grid{padding-top:280px;padding-bottom:260px}.pluses__text{font-size:22px}.pluses__img{width:600px}}@media screen and (max-width:991px){.pluses__grid{padding-top:90px;padding-bottom:450px}.pluses__text{text-align:center;font-size:24px}.pluses__img{top:unset;bottom:15px;left:50%;right:unset;width:500px;height:367px;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%)}}@media screen and (max-width:575px){.pluses__grid{padding-top:76px;padding-bottom:417px}.pluses__text{font-size:18px;text-align:center;font-weight:700}.pluses__text br{display:none}.pluses .container{overflow:hidden}.pluses__img{top:unset;bottom:15px;left:-29px;right:unset;width:551px;height:367px;-webkit-transform:none;-ms-transform:none;transform:none}}.pluses__bg{position:absolute;z-index:1;left:0;right:0;bottom:0;top:0;display:block;width:100%;height:100%}.why{padding:104px 0 142px;position:relative}.why:before{content:"";position:absolute;right:0;top:0;bottom:0;z-index:1;display:block;width:50%;height:100%;background:#f4f7fe}.why .container{z-index:2}.why__title{margin-bottom:44px}.why__grid{display:grid;grid-template-columns:repeat(3,1fr);grid-auto-rows:376px;gap:22px}@media screen and (max-width:1299px){.why{padding:80px 0 125px}.why__grid{grid-auto-rows:350px}}@media screen and (max-width:991px){.why{padding:70px 0 100px}.why__grid{grid-template-columns:repeat(2,1fr);grid-auto-rows:350px}}.why__item{position:relative;z-index:1}@media screen and (max-width:575px){.pluses__bg{top:unset;height:500px}.why{padding:60px 0 99px}.why__grid{grid-template-columns:100%;grid-auto-rows:307px;gap:20px}.why__item{max-width:330px;margin:0 auto}}.why__item:after{content:"";position:absolute;left:15px;right:15px;bottom:0;z-index:-1;display:block;height:20px;border-radius:25px;-webkit-box-shadow:0 10px 19px rgba(0,0,0,.1);box-shadow:0 10px 19px rgba(0,0,0,.1)}.why__item-bg{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;position:relative;z-index:2;height:100%;padding:44px 32px 33px;background:#fff;border-radius:25px}@media screen and (max-width:991px){.why__item-bg{padding:35px 25px 25px}}.why__item-number{font-family:RFDewiExtended;font-style:normal;font-weight:700;font-size:20px;line-height:143.84%;background:-o-linear-gradient(183.08deg,#6395f8 6.31%,#b68fff 91.68%);background:linear-gradient(266.92deg,#6395f8 6.31%,#b68fff 91.68%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-fill-color:transparent;width:-webkit-max-content;width:-moz-max-content;width:max-content}.why__item-body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:end;-ms-flex-pack:end;justify-content:flex-end}.why__item-title{margin-bottom:16px;font-family:RFDewiExtended;font-style:normal;font-weight:700;font-size:20px;line-height:120%;color:#344463}.why__item-text{min-height:88px;margin:0;font-family:SFProText;font-style:normal;font-weight:400;font-size:15px;line-height:143.84%;color:#344463}@media screen and (max-width:575px){.why__item-bg{padding:44px 30px 40px}.why__item-text{min-height:80px;font-size:14px}}.offer{padding:116px 0 123px}@media screen and (max-width:1299px){.offer{padding:100px 0 115px}}@media screen and (max-width:991px){.offer{padding:85px 0 115px}}.offer__body{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.offer__title{margin-bottom:32px}@media screen and (max-width:575px){.offer{padding:75px 0 115px}.offer__title{margin-bottom:24px}}.offer__text{margin-bottom:32px;font-family:RFDewiExtended;font-style:normal;font-weight:600;font-size:20px;line-height:135%;text-align:center;color:#344463}@media screen and (max-width:575px){.offer__text{font-size:18px}}
/*# sourceMappingURL=../sourcemaps/main.min.css.map */
